THE UNITE GROUP PLC
UNITE APPOINTS ELIAZABETH McMEIKAN AS SENIOR INDEPENDENT
DIRECTOR AND ROSS PATERSON AS AUDIT COMMITTEE CHAIR
The Unite Group plc, the UK's largest provider of student
accommodation, announces the appointments of Elizabeth McMeikan
(Non-Executive Director and Chair of the Remuneration Committee) as
Senior Independent Director and Ross Paterson (Non-Executive
Director) as Chair of the Audit Committee. These appointments
follow the tragic and sudden death of Manjit Wolstenholme announced
on 24 November 2017. The appointments take effect immediately.
Elizabeth McMeikan joined Unite in 2014. She has significant
experience of working in customer-focused businesses, including
Tesco and Colgate Palmolive. Elizabeth is the Senior Independent
Director at JD Wetherspoon plc and Chair of the Remuneration
Committee at Flybe plc.
Ross Paterson joined Unite in 2017. He is already a member of
the Audit Committee and, as a qualified accountant with extensive
experience of managing finance in complex operational environments,
is well placed to chair this Committee. He is currently Finance
Director at Stagecoach Group plc and chairs the Audit Committee at
Virgin Rail Group Holdings Limited.
Phil White, Chairman of Unite, commented:
"These appointments reflect our ongoing commitment to
maintaining the best mixture of knowledge, experience and expertise
on our board, following the tragic death of our valued colleague
Manjit Wolstenholme. The appointments of Liz and Ross are very
well-deserved and reflect the valuable contributions both have
already made to Unite."

About Unite Students
Unite Students is the UK's largest and most established manager
and developer of purpose-built student accommodation. It provides a
home for around 50,000 students, in more than 140 properties,
across 24 leading university cities in England and Scotland. Unite
works in partnership with more than 60 Higher Education
institutions and also lets rooms directly to students.
Unite's purpose is to provide a home to its culturally diverse
customers, offering them a strong foundation for academic and
personal success. The accommodation is high quality, safe and close
to university campuses, transport links and local amenities.
Students live in ensuite study bedrooms with rents covering all
bills, insurance, 24-hour security, fortnightly cleaning of
communal kitchens and bathrooms and high-speed Wi-Fi.
Founded in 1991 in Bristol, the Unite Group plc is a FTSE250
company, listed on the London Stock Exchange, employing more than
1,400 people. It pursues a sustainable growth strategy, designed to
make the most of the resilient nature of the student accommodation
sector. Unite is focused on maintaining its position as the leading
provider of student accommodation in the UK, by having the best
brand, operating the highest quality portfolio and maintaining the
strongest capital structure in the sector. This is achieved with
consistent investment in, and improvement to, the operating
platform; highly selective development activity and asset
management initiatives.
Unite is invested in and operates two specialist funds and joint
ventures with institutional investment partners, the GBP2 billion
Unite UK Student Accommodation Fund (USAF) and the GBP1 billion
London Student Accommodation Vehicle (LSAV).
Unite is the founder and major donor of the Unite Foundation.
Since 2012, this has provided free student accommodation and
financial support to 160 young people in the UK who lack family
support.
